Another meeting on the diamond.
That could be a reality later this week for Belle’s Tigers and Vienna’s Eagles during the Stoutland Fall Baseball Tournament.
Last Thursday in Vienna, Belle scored two first-inning runs when Zane Strunk reached on an error allowing Kaiden Robertson and Ruger Schlottog to score.
Gavin Schwartze reached on an error and scored in the bottom of the seventh before Vienna left the tying and go-ahead runs on the bases in their 2-1 loss to the visiting Tigers.
Depending on how pool play in the upcoming Stoutland Tournament pans out, Belle and Vienna could meet for a third time this fall on the baseball diamond on Friday in Stoutland.
Teams in Pool ‘A’ include Newburg, Stoutland and Vienna while Pool ‘B’ consists of Belle, Bourbon and Otterville.
Tomorrow (Thursday) in Pool ‘A’ games at Stoutland, Vienna will face the host Tigers at 4 p.m., before taking on Newburg at 6 p.m.
Pool ‘B’ action in Belle will start with the host Tigers taking on Bourbon at 4 p.m., before concluding pool play at approximately 8 p.m., against Otterville.
Tournament action will conclude on Friday in Stoutland with the third-place teams in each pool facing off at 4 p.m., followed by the second-place teams in each pool facing each other at approximately 6 p.m.
Capping the tournament will be the championship game between the top teams in each pool with an approximate 8 p.m., first pitch.
